This subject offers an interactive introduction to discrete mathematics oriented toward computer science and engineering. The subject coverage divides roughly into thirds: 1. Fundamental concepts of mathematics: Definitions, proofs, sets, functions, relations. 2. Discrete structures: graphs, state machines, modular arithmetic, counting. 3. Discrete probability theory. Data Structures, 01:198:206 - Introduction to Discrete Structures II; This course is a Pre-requisite for the Following Courses: 01:198:452 - Formal Languages and Automata;Discrete Structures is mainly a weird math class that involves little to no coding at all. Topics include propositional logic, basic set theory, mathematical inductive reasoning, etc. I mainly just got through this class by reading the textbook and attending lectures.Except where otherwise noted, readings are from the free online textbook Elements of Discrete Mathematics by Richard Hammack. Sets: Sections 2.1-2.7; Handout on the summation (sigma) and product (pi) notations • Section 2.8; Logic I: Chapter 3; Counting: Sections 4.1-4.8; Discrete Probability: Chapter 5, except for Section 4; Algorithms ...
